When you call our perpetual emergency hotline, our knowledgeable staff without delay acquires essential information about your Rocky Mount, North Carolina property and assigns the nearest response team. We acknowledge that every hour counts.
Upon arrival, our certified technicians perform a extensive inspection of your Rocky Mount, North Carolina property. Using state-of-the-art humidity measuring equipment, we uncover all affected areas, including hidden moisture locations.
We forthwith embark on water extraction using powerful pumps and vacuum units. The faster we discharge the water, the less damage your Rocky Mount, North Carolina property will sustain.
After water pumping, we strategically place air movers and dehumidifiers throughout the affected areas. Our technicians watch progress daily, adjusting equipment as warranted to ensure peak drying.
We treat, hygienize, and deodorize all contaminated areas and belongings. Relative to the range of corruption, we may use antimicrobial treatments to prevent mold growth.
The final step consists of restoring your Rocky Mount, North Carolina property to its pre-damage condition. This may involve slight repairs like renewing drywall and resurfacing, or comprehensive rehabilitation of total rooms.

We process all types of water damage including potable water, gray water, and black water damage. This includes inundation, line failures, roof leaks, sanitary sewer problems, and more.
The timeline varies based on the extent of damage. Typically, the drying process takes around a week, while complete restoration may take 1-2 weeks or greater length for extensive damage.

If practical to do so, you can disable the water source, remove critical items from the wet area, and capture images of the damage for insurance records. However, your health comes before anything do not walk into standing water if there's any risk of electrical hazards.
